#001cf3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#001cf3 is composed of 0% red, 11% green and 95.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 100% cyan, 88.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 233.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 47.6%. #001cf3 color hex could be obtained by blending #0038ff with #0000e7. Closest websafe color is: #0033ff.

Shades and Tints of #001cf3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000108 is the darkest color, while #f3f4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#001cf3
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#707283 is the less saturated color, while #001cf3 is the most saturated one.
